A Global Certificate Course in Digital Libraries equips participants with the skills and knowledge necessary to manage and utilize digital library resources effectively. This comprehensive program covers various aspects, from metadata creation and cataloging to digital preservation strategies and user interface design for optimal online access.
Learning outcomes include a deep understanding of digital library systems, proficiency in metadata schemas like Dublin Core and MARC, and expertise in digital preservation techniques. Graduates will be capable of implementing and managing digital collections, ensuring accessibility and longevity of digital content.
